If you're unfamiliar with the term, LMS stands for Learning Management System. These systems allow trainers or educators to create and manage online courses with engaging content designed to capture your imagination. Gone are the days when learning was just about listening. Now, it's all about interaction, engagement, and personalization.

The best LMS systems put the learner first by providing them with an intuitive interface that guides them through their learning journey. They do this by using cutting-edge AI technologies that personalize content based on individual needs and preferences. They offer seamless integration with different devices so learners can access their courses anywhere at any time.

Here are some benefits of using an innovative LMS that can transform your training experience:

1. Personalized Learning

An innovative Learning Management System (LMS) offers transformative learning experiences by integrating personalized learning capabilities. With a conventional one-size-fits-all approach, learners' diverse needs, skills, and knowledge gaps often remain unaddressed. However, with an LMS tailored to individual learning styles, employees can interact with the content that resonates with them the most and at a pace that matches their learning curve. Adaptive learning paths are integral to this process, allowing learners to navigate the training journey flexibly and confidently. Moreover, such an approach reinforces learning, leading to better absorption and application of knowledge. Therefore, personalization stands at the forefront of an improved and effective training program.

2. Cost-Effective Alternative

While implementing an LMS requires an initial investment, the cost-effectiveness of such systems becomes evident in the long run. By digitizing and centralizing training materials, an LMS can reduce costs associated with traditional training methods, such as travel expenses, venue hire, and instructor fees. Additionally, the efficient distribution and reuse of digital content can lead to substantial savings. When you consider the improved training outcomes, increased productivity, and enhanced employee satisfaction that result from effective training, the return on investment for an innovative LMS is considerable. Thus, cost-effectiveness is a significant advantage of using an LMS for your training needs.

3. Enhanced Engagement Through Gamification

The incorporation of gamification features like badges, leaderboards, points, and levels in an LMS can turn the often monotonous learning process into an engaging and motivational experience. By stimulating a sense of competition and achievement, gamification strategies boost engagement levels and promote a deeper connection with the learning material. These elements increase motivation to complete courses, enhance the retention of information, and ultimately lead to the practical application of acquired knowledge. Hence, gamification in an innovative LMS can transform your training experience by making learning fun and effective.

4. Social Learning Opportunities

Many innovative LMS platforms embed social learning features into their design, offering opportunities like discussion forums, collaborative projects, and peer feedback mechanisms. These interactive tools encourage communication and collaboration among learners, fostering an environment of mutual growth. By facilitating knowledge sharing, they allow learners to gain from each other's experiences and perspectives. Social learning makes the training process more interactive and less isolating, enhancing the overall learning experience. Moreover, it develops crucial soft skills like teamwork and communication, which are vital in the modern workplace.

5. Advanced Analytics and Reporting

Advanced analytics and reporting form the backbone of an innovative LMS. Comprehensive data about learner progress, course completion rates, engagement levels, and test scores provide critical insights into the effectiveness of your training program. This data can inform decisions about course improvement, tailoring of content, and strategic planning of future learning initiatives. Additionally, metrics related to the application of learned skills can be instrumental in assessing the practical impact of training on workplace performance. Hence, robust analytics and reporting functions can lead to better decision-making and enhanced training outcomes.

6. Mobile Learning Support

Modern learners are constantly on the go and need flexibility in how and when they learn. Innovative LMS platforms cater to this need by supporting mobile learning. This functionality enables learners to access training material at their convenience, whether during a commute, on a break, or outside of typical working hours. The compatibility of an LMS with mobile devices suits the modern learner's lifestyle and leads to higher course completion rates. By removing barriers to access, mobile learning promotes a culture of continuous learning and professional development.

7. Streamlined Administrative Tasks

Administrative tasks associated with training, such as enrollment, progress tracking, and report generation, can be tedious and time-consuming. However, an innovative LMS can automate these tasks, significantly reducing the administrative burden. Automation allows trainers and HR professionals to focus more on strategic tasks like developing engaging content, refining training strategies, and analyzing training data. By streamlining administrative processes, an innovative LMS improves operational efficiency and leads to a smoother, more manageable training experience.

8. Scalability for Growing Businesses

Scalability is a crucial feature to consider when choosing an LMS. Your training needs will also change and expand as your business grows and evolves. An innovative LMS can seamlessly accommodate this growth, allowing you to add new users and courses without compromising the quality of the learning experience. The ability to scale helps ensure that your LMS remains a valuable resource, irrespective of your organization's size or the complexity of your training needs. Therefore, investing in a scalable LMS is a strategic move that can support your business's long-term growth and success.
